We are seeking a skilled and passionate Bartender to join a distinguished luxury hospitality group in Qatar. The ideal candidate will have a talent for crafting exceptional beverages, delivering outstanding guest service, and upholding the highest standards of cleanliness and professionalism at all times.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Prepare and serve beverages in line with luxury hospitality standards.
  • Greet guests warmly and ensure an exceptional bar experience.
  • Set up the bar with necessary supplies including liquor, glassware, garnishes, and ice.
  • Mix drinks accurately and consistently according to beverage manuals and standard measures.
  • Handle orders and billing processes quickly and correctly.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and secure bar area throughout the shift.
  • Receive and verify stock, report any discrepancies to the F&B Supervisor.
  • Collaborate with the team to ensure smooth bar operations during service hours.
  • Uphold hygiene, safety, and sanitation standards.
  • Assist with end-of-shift duties including cleanup and stock replenishment.

Qualifications & Skills:

  • High school diploma or equivalent, with training certificates in bartending from an accredited institute.
  • Minimum 1–2 years of bartending experience in a luxury hotel, high-end café, or premium hospitality environment.
  • Strong knowledge of cocktail preparation and bar equipment.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• A genuine passion for hospitality and guest satisfaction.
  • Fluent in English; proficiency in Arabic and/or Russian is an advantage.
  • Well-groomed with a professional appearance.
  • Flexible to work shifts, weekends, and holidays.
